Open-weight artificial intelligence models offer an alternative system that enables businesses to run advanced AI technologies locally—either for free or at a low cost—allowing them to avoid the hefty monthly subscription fees charged by cloud-based AI services. Thanks to these models, companies can develop custom AI solutions without straining their budgets and maintain full control by keeping their data on their own servers.
Advantages of Open-Weight Models for Businesses
Closed-source and subscription-based AI tools can become a significant financial burden for businesses as usage volume increases. Open-weight models, on the other hand, give companies the opportunity to download model weights onto their own infrastructure and customize them. This approach also brings security and privacy advantages, particularly for organizations handling sensitive data that do not want to send information to third-party servers.
Requirements for Local Execution
Running these models efficiently on your own hardware requires selecting the right software and hardware components. Depending on the scale of the workload, powerful graphics processing units (GPUs), adequate RAM capacity, and open-source software tools that facilitate local model management are necessary. The right hardware investment ensures savings on cloud API costs in the long run.
Sectoral Implications and Cost Optimization
For businesses looking to optimize their AI budgets, transitioning to open-weight models offers a scalable strategy. Choosing the model that best suits a company's specific use cases prevents unnecessary resource consumption and boosts operational efficiency.
Frequently Asked Questions
Is it mandatory for every business to invest in expensive servers to use open-weight AI models?
No, small and medium-sized models can also be run on standard workstations or cost-effective rented cloud servers; the investment cost is determined by the size of the model the business requires.
What is the main difference between open-source and open-weight AI models?
While the term "open-source" generally indicates that all source code and development processes are transparent, open-weight models share the trained parameters of the model, though the complete code or datasets may not always be public.
